Looking for SISTEMAS OPERATIVOS test answers and solutions? Browse our comprehensive collection of verified answers for SISTEMAS OPERATIVOS at moodle.uam.es.
Get instant access to accurate answers and detailed explanations for your course questions. Our community-driven platform helps students succeed!
¿Existe alguna forma en LINUX de ver qué colas ha creado nuestro sistema?
A la hora de leer un mensaje de la cola con la función mq_receive
, ¿dónde se encuentra el mensaje que hemos leído?
Dado la siguiente estructura para crear una cola:
struct mq_attr attributes = {
.mq_flags = 0,
.mq_maxmsg = 10,
.mq_msgsize = 100,
.mq_curmsg = 0
}
¿Cuántos bytes puede ocupar un mensaje como máximo en la cola de mensajes?
¿Cómo deben de ser los nombres de las colas de mensajes?
Dado el siguiente código:
...
mq_send(mq, &msg1, sizeof(msg1), 2);
mq_send(mq, &msg2, sizeof(msg2), 1);
mq_send(mq, &msg3, sizeof(msg3), 3);
...
¿En qué orden leerá los mensajes el receptor?
¿Cuál es la principal diferencia entre usar una tubería y una cola de mensajes?
Dado la siguiente estructura para crear una cola:
struct mq_attr attributes = {
.mq_flags = 0,
.mq_maxmsg = 10,
.mq_msgsize = 100,
.mq_curmsg = 0
}
¿Cuántos mensajes puede contener la cola de mensajes?
Al abrir una cola de mensajes con la función mq_open()
, ¿qué valores puede devolver?
¿Cómo lee un receptor los mensajes de una cola de mensajes?
¿Dónde se puede consultar los mapas de memoria añadidos a un proceso?
Get Unlimited Answers To Exam Questions - Install Crowdly Extension Now!